§ 6563. — 6563. (Added by Stats. 2021, Ch. 417, Sec. 1.)

California·Code BPC Business and Professions Code - BPC·Div. 3. DIVISION 3. PROFESSIONS AND VOCATIONS GENERALLY·Ch. 6. CHAPTER 6. Professional Fiduciaries·Art. 4. ARTICLE 4. Practice Provisions
(a)On or before January 1, 2023, a licensee with an internet website shall post on that internet website a schedule or range of the licensee’s fees, including, but not limited to, hourly fees, for services offered.
(b)On or after January 1, 2023, a licensee who does not have an internet website shall do all of the following:
(1)Provide a prospective client, before the execution of a contract for services, a schedule or range of the licensee’s fees, including, but not limited to, hourly fees, for services offered.
(2)Upon receipt of a request, provide a client with a schedule or range of the licensee’s fees, including, but not limited to, hourly fees, for services offered.
